myBiz ICICI Bank Business+ Credit Card VS Aditya Birla AU Bank Credit Cards
Both myBiz ICICI Bank Business+ Credit Card and Aditya Birla AU Bank Credit Cards suit travel-focused spenders, but they earn and cost differently. myBiz ICICI Bank Business+ Credit Card costs ₹2,500 + GST and earns 1.25-4 myBiz Cash for every ₹200 spent, with highest rates on MMT myBiz flights/hotels. Aditya Birla AU Bank Credit Cards is lifetime-free and earns up to 10X Reward Points on select categories like Travel, Dining, Utilities; up to 6X on online spends. myBiz ICICI Bank Business+ Credit Card also brings 2 complimentary domestic airport lounge visits per quarter at participating lounges in India, while Aditya Birla AU Bank Credit Cards counters with complimentary domestic lounge access; 2 per quarter with Pro, or 1 per quarter optionally with Flex/Nxt. Cons
Key drawbacks and limitations.
Benefits are largely concentrated on myBiz MMT travel bookings, limiting broader utility.
A foreign currency markup of 3.5% applies to international transactions, increasing costs.
A redemption fee of ₹99 is charged for converting myBiz Cash, reducing overall value.
